Fig. 6. Phosphorylation of cPLA2
at Ser505. (A) Immunocytochemistry with antibody to cPLA2
phosphorylated at Ser505 and to calbindin D. Treatment with 200 nM PMA for 20 minutes triggered marked phosphorylation of cPLA2
, whereas stimulation with glutamate-receptor agonists alone (100 µM glutamate or 30 µM AMPA for 3 minutes) had little effect. Pre-treatment with 10 µM U0126 for 30 minutes completely blocked the phosphorylation of cPLA2
that was induced by the combination of PMA and AMPA. Scale bar: 10 µm. (B) Quantification of experiments. The average fluorescence intensity of phosphorylated cPLA2
in proximal dendrites after treatment with glutamate-receptor agonists and/or PMA was calculated. The values are means ± s.e.m. (n=13-30 for each condition). ***P<0.001.
